FEZ


Meaning of FEZ in English

/ fez; NAmE / noun

( pl. fezzes ) a round red hat with a flat top and a tassel but no brim , worn by men in some Muslim countries

WORD ORIGIN

early 19th cent.: from Turkish fes (perhaps via French fez ), named after Fez, a city in northern Morocco, once the chief place of manufacture.
